The Importance Of Curriculum Development In Education

curriculum development is a crucial aspect of education that plays a significant role in determining the quality and effectiveness of teaching and learning. It refers to the process of creating, implementing, and evaluating the educational courses and programs that students undertake in schools, colleges, and universities. curriculum development is essential for ensuring that students receive a well-rounded education that prepares them for success in the future.

One of the key reasons why curriculum development is important is that it helps educators and policymakers design educational programs that align with the goals and objectives of education. By carefully planning and organizing the curriculum, educators can ensure that students are exposed to a wide range of subjects and topics that are essential for their intellectual and personal development. A well-designed curriculum also helps students develop critical and analytical thinking skills, as well as problem-solving abilities that are essential for success in the real world.

Furthermore, curriculum development plays a crucial role in promoting innovation and creativity in education. By constantly updating and revising the curriculum to incorporate new knowledge and ideas, educators can ensure that students are exposed to the latest developments in their field of study. This helps students stay abreast of current trends and advancements in the world, and encourages them to think outside the box and come up with creative solutions to complex problems.

Another important benefit of curriculum development is that it helps educators tailor their teaching methods and approaches to the needs and learning styles of their students. By taking into account the diverse backgrounds and abilities of students, educators can create a curriculum that is engaging, relevant, and accessible to all learners. This personalized approach to education not only enhances the learning experience for students but also helps them achieve their full potential and excel in their academic pursuits.

Moreover, curriculum development is essential for ensuring that educational programs meet the standards and requirements set by accrediting bodies and regulatory agencies. By following a systematic process of curriculum development, educators can ensure that their programs meet the necessary criteria for accreditation and are in compliance with national and international educational standards. This not only helps maintain the credibility and reputation of educational institutions but also ensures that students receive a high-quality education that is recognized and valued by employers and other academic institutions.

In addition, curriculum development helps educators and policymakers address the changing needs and demands of society. As the world becomes increasingly interconnected and complex, it is important for educational programs to adapt and evolve to meet the challenges of the 21st century. By continuously reviewing and updating the curriculum, educators can ensure that students are equipped with the knowledge and skills they need to thrive in a rapidly changing world and contribute meaningfully to society.
